Understanding Bershka’s Pricing Strategy
Bershka, as part of the Inditex group (which also includes Zara, Pull&Bear, and others), operates with a fast-fashion business model. This means they release new collections frequently, keeping up with the latest trends. Their pricing strategy is designed to offer trendy products at accessible price points, appealing to a younger demographic.
Several factors influence the price of Bershka sandals:
- Material: The materials used significantly impact the cost. Sandals made of genuine leather or high-quality synthetic materials will typically be more expensive than those made with basic synthetic fabrics.
- Design and Embellishments: Sandals with intricate designs, embellishments (like studs, beads, or embroidery), or unique details will often come with a higher price tag.
- Style: Popular styles, like platform sandals or those featuring collaborations, may be priced higher due to their demand and design complexity.
- Seasonality: Prices can fluctuate depending on the season and current promotions. End-of-season sales often offer significant discounts.
- Production Costs: Labor and manufacturing expenses also contribute to the final price.
By understanding these factors, you can better anticipate the cost of the sandals you’re interested in.
General Price Range for Bershka Sandals
The price of Bershka sandals generally falls within a specific range, but it’s important to remember that this can vary based on the factors mentioned above. Here’s a general overview:
- Basic Sandals: These include simple flat sandals, flip-flops, and basic slides. You can typically find these for around €15 to €30 (or the equivalent in your local currency).
- Mid-Range Sandals: This category encompasses sandals with more design elements, such as strappy sandals, espadrilles, and sandals with small heels or platforms. Expect to pay between €30 and €50.
- Premium Sandals: These often feature higher-quality materials, more elaborate designs, or collaborations. Prices can range from €50 to €80 or even slightly higher.
Important Note: These prices are estimates and can change based on the current collection, regional pricing, and any ongoing sales or promotions. It’s always a good idea to check the Bershka website or your local store for the most up-to-date pricing.

Materials and Their Impact on Price
The materials used in Bershka sandals greatly influence their cost. Here’s a breakdown of common materials and how they affect the price:
- Synthetic Materials: These are the most common and affordable materials. They include polyurethane (PU), polyvinyl chloride (PVC), and other synthetic fabrics. Sandals made with these materials are generally priced lower, from €15 to €40.
- Textile Fabrics: Canvas, cotton, and other textile fabrics are often used for straps or the upper part of the sandal. Prices for sandals using these materials usually range from €20 to €45.
- Faux Leather: Faux leather (often PU or other synthetic materials) is used to mimic the look of genuine leather. Sandals with faux leather uppers typically cost between €25 and €50.
- Genuine Leather: Leather sandals are usually at the higher end of the price range due to the material’s quality and durability. They can range from €40 to €80 or more, depending on the design.
- Other Materials: Bershka may also use other materials like rubber for soles, metal for buckles, and various embellishments like beads or studs. These can impact the overall price based on their type and complexity.
Understanding the materials used can help you gauge the expected price and assess the value of the sandals.
Seasonal Sales and Promotions
Bershka frequently runs sales and promotions, offering opportunities to purchase sandals at discounted prices. Here’s what you can expect:
- End-of-Season Sales: At the end of each season (summer, in this case), Bershka typically offers significant discounts on remaining sandal stock. These sales are a great time to find bargains, with prices often reduced by 30% to 70% or more.
- Mid-Season Sales: Bershka may have mid-season sales to clear out specific collections or make room for new arrivals. Discounts can vary but often range from 20% to 50%.
- Promotional Events: During holidays or special events, Bershka might offer special promotions, such as discounts on specific sandal styles or a percentage off your entire purchase.
- Online Exclusives: Sometimes, Bershka offers exclusive discounts or promotions through its website or app.
- Clearance Sections: Always check the clearance sections on the website or in-store for heavily discounted items.

Comparing Bershka Sandals to Competitors
Bershka competes with several other fast-fashion brands and retailers. Comparing their pricing can give you a better idea of value. Here’s a brief comparison:
- Zara: Zara, also part of the Inditex group, often has a similar price range to Bershka, but may offer slightly higher quality materials and more sophisticated designs.
- Pull&Bear: Another Inditex brand, Pull&Bear generally offers similar pricing to Bershka, with a focus on more casual and youthful styles.
- H&M: H&M offers a wide range of sandals at generally comparable prices to Bershka. They often have sales and promotions.
- ASOS: ASOS, an online retailer, carries a vast selection of sandals from various brands, including their own brand. Prices can vary widely, but they often offer competitive pricing and frequent sales.
- Boohoo/PrettyLittleThing: These online retailers often have lower prices than Bershka, but the quality may vary.
